Transaction 62fb61aec52dbd67af5dcc2ae6afbcca1f88db10984be721396ae093abdf1136
1 Input
1 Output
-
62fb61aec52dbd67af5dcc2ae6afbcca1f88db10984be721396ae093abdf1136:0
- value
- 1097246
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1c9c95b8aa00adbeeebf02888998323f9f55698
- address
- bc1qk8yujku25q9dhmht7q5g3xvry0ul245c7w705f